JEE Physics Practice Question
A particle, of mass $10^{-3} \mathrm{~kg}$ and charge $1.0 \mathrm{C}$, is initially at rest. At time $t=0$, the particle comes under the influence of an electric field $\vec{E}(t)=E_{0} \sin \omega t \hat{i}$, where $E_{0}=1.0 \mathrm{~N}^{-1}$ and $\omega=10^{3} \mathrm{rad} \mathrm{s}^{-1}$. Consider the effect of only the electrical force on the particle. Then what is the maximum speed, in $m s^{-1}$, attained by the particle at subsequent times?
